基于行程时间可靠性的车辆优化调度

     

摘要

Although uncertainty on travel time is an important aspect of routing for many freight carriers, the existing works on goods vehicle fleet management problem do not take into account the uncertainty on travel time resulting from the fluctuations of traffic flows on congested roads in urban road network. This paper introduces the constraint of the travel time reliability into the goods vehicle fleet management problem particularly for the just-in-time delivery of goods such as the ready-mixed concrete. The mathematical model formulation of the reliability-constrained vehicle fleet management problem is presented together with the heuristic solution algorithm. An example network is used to illustrate the applications of the proposed model and solution algorithm. It was found that the total travel time of goods vehicle fleet is increased when the required travel time reliability is increased.%行程时间的不确定性是影响货运车队路径选择的一个重要因素,特别是对于要求货物准时送达的配送任务(例如商品混凝土的配送).提出了在车辆调度中考虑由拥挤路段交通流量波动引起的行程时间不确定性的方法,建立了考虑行程时间可靠性要求的车辆优化调度数学模型,给出了相应的启发式算法.通过算例介绍了该模型和算法的应用.结果表明配送总成本随行程时间可靠性要求的提高而增加.
